Hello guys,
can somebody help me with following problem?
I need to backup Oracle database (many of them) using b/a TSM client by
putting Oracle into backup mode and backup all Oracle data files.
Because of activity on Oracle database, before putting Oracle database
into backup mode, I need to be sure that I have available tape drive for
backup
(backup will be done LAN-free using TSM STA).
My idea is to use script, which will select empty (or available, ie.
loaded but not used - idle) drives from drives table using select command
and then put one of them to offline until I have Oracle in backup mode,
and then put this drive back to online just before backup starts.
My problem is that from drives table it is not possible to get enough
information about state and activity of the drive. There is only
information whether drive is loaded or not.
Using "q mount" command I can get also information whether drive is "in
use" or "idle".
Is it possible to get this information also using some select command? Or
any other ideas?
